Quarterly Planning Note — Sarvik Technologies

The licensing dispute with Orvane Dynamics continues. Counsel advises settlement is preferable to litigation; exposure estimated at mid-six figures. Product shipments using the contested module are paused. Engineering is assessing a workaround; timeline two months. Heads of department should hold related customer commitments. Budget provisions stand. The contingency plan is set out below.

confidential, yagep-kagef: Rusvanox Holdings is in early talks to buy Julwynix Systems for about $454.5 million. The Fenael launch date is April 23, and nothing goes to the press before then. Legal wants the Druwynix Works term sheet redrafted before January 8.

Subject: Blueprints for the Garnet Row permit — Thursday run

Hi dispatch team, the full blueprint set for the Garnet Row building permit is rolled, tubed, and waiting at the Thistledown Architects front counter. The planning office at Westfall Civic Hall needs them before their noon cut-off Thursday, so please slot this into the morning run. Keep the tubes dry and don't let anyone flatten them in the van — these are the stamped originals and there's no second set. The courier hand-over instruction follows on the next line.

courier memo of yahif-faweg: the quenael tamius courier leaves the prawyn jorix kaswyn istox silmir brieth zormir fenvan ledger at gate 3145 under passcode 231062

# Transcoding farm constants — Reelsmith cluster, Ostermark region.
# Welcome aboard. Each worker pulls one mezzanine file at a time and
# fans out renditions in parallel; the limits below exist to keep GPU
# memory from fragmenting under long 4K jobs. Please read the scheduler
# docs before changing anything: concurrency, retry backoff, and segment
# length interact in non-obvious ways, and a bad combination can stall
# the whole farm for hours. The constants currently in effect follow here.

tuning table, fawip-fahag:
WEIGHTS = {
    "novwyn": 452,
    "casdor": 675,
}